How this opportunity is different

Our Transaction Advisory team is passionate about being the leading provider of specialist transaction related advice. Our capabilities include Cyber Security, Climate impact analysis plus Risk & Insurance and Human Capital (pension, health and benefits, compensation, talent). We advise clients through the transaction cycle from pre‑deal due diligence, post close consulting, sell‑side preparation and vendor due diligence. Cyber M&A has been a critical growth driver for the team. As the team continues to grow we are now looking to recruit an Associate Director to support the next phase on the team's expansion.
